The National Security Sector (NSS) seeks highly qualified and trained Cyberspace Operational Planners to serve as Cyber Capability Integrators, responsible for designing, deploying, and managing complex cybersecurity solutions by combining various systems and tools to form a cohesive, effective security posture.
The role focuses on ensuring that disparate security technologies and processes work seamlessly together to defend an organization from both physical and cyber threats.
** The individual filling this role will participate in the program’s robust cross training program and be certified and willing to support surge requirements by serving in mission critical JOC roles for a short duration, if required. This opportunity is in anticipation of a future contract award.
What you’ll be doing :
* Act as a crucial bridge between end-users (like the warfighter) and the development and integration of new cyber systems and technologies, ensuring that solutions meet user needs and operational requirements.
* Key responsibilities include providing user feedback, conducting research and analysis, developing and implementing software/hardware capabilities, assisting with policy and documentation, and coordinating with various teams to ensure successful implementation and compliance with security standards.
* Serve as a primary user representative, providing feedback and ensuring that new cyber capabilities meet the needs of the warfighter and operational forces.
* Analyze system vulnerabilities and user needs to research, develop, and implement new cyber capabilities, both software and hardware.
* Coordinate the integration of new technologies into existing systems, identifying and assessing dependencies with other programs and organizations.
* Provide technical expertise on cybersecurity functions and technologies, including network security, defensive tools, and advanced communications.
* Assist with the creation and maintenance of program documentation, policies, and procedures to ensure compliance with relevant regulations and security standards.
* Train users on new capabilities and provide guidance on the use and application of cyber tools and technologies.
* Demonstrate knowledge of cyber threats and attack methods and techniques emanating from state and non-state adversaries and tiered vulnerabilities within Blue Space as focus of threats.
* Develop and execute comprehensive programs for assessing CO and validating operational performance characteristics.
* Review, approve, prioritize, and submit operational needs for research, development, and/or acquisition of cyber capabilities.
* Communicate complex information, concepts, or ideas in a confident and well-organized manner through verbal, written, and/or visual means. What does Leidos need from me?
